How they compare

American Samoa currently reports 40.97 against 6.86 in África Oriental y Meridional, a difference of 34.11.

That makes American Samoa's figure about 6.0 times África Oriental y Meridional's.

Across all 25 years both countries report, American Samoa has been ahead every year.

África Oriental y Meridional ranks 57th and American Samoa ranks 57th of 61 groups.

American Samoa has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ade África Oriental y Meridional American Samoa Difference Ahead
2000s 2.06 44.9 42.85 American Samoa
2010s 6.03 44.23 38.2 American Samoa
2020s 8.01 41.58 33.56 American Samoa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
